1. Los Angeles Rams The only negative now for the team is losing DB’s Aqib Talib for a month and Marcus Peters for possibly a few weeks. Other wise this team has been so dominant out the gate and have a quality win under their belt. 2. Kansas City Chiefs Patrick Mahomes has absolutely been a Godsend to the Kansas City franchise. An NFL record 13 touchdowns through 3 games. My lone concern for the Chiefs is their defense which currently ranks 32nd in the NFL. They can’t stop a nose bleed. 3. Philadelphia Eagles The return of Carson Wentz was not pretty. But they got the win against a frisky Colts team. 4. Jacksonville Jaguars I was afraid of the let down factor after last week’s win over New England. Plus Tennessee always poses issues to the Jags. Only reason they did not fall further in the rankings this week is other fellow top 10ers also let down in a big way. 5. New Orleans Saints It’s clear that as long as Drew Brees is healthy he has a few more quality seasons in him. What a terrific performance in Atlanta vs. a divisional opponent. They made a huge jump in the rankings. 6. Carolina Panthers No one is paying attention to this team. Plus Cam Newton is quietly putting together another MVP type season. I said coming into the season that the Panthers were the biggest dark horse in the NFC. 7. New England Patriots A 1-2 start and some are beginning to panic. This is the first time in a number of years the Patriots have lost back to back games by double digits. It here is why I’m reluctant to panic this early. They get Julian Edelman in another week. The team still have not implemented newly acquired Josh Gordon to the team. This week’s matchup vs. the Miami Dolphins will go a long way as to where this team is at. A 1-3 start will definitely raise the volume on doubters. 8. Miami Dolphins Whether or not you believe this team is for real, through three weeks they have not lost a single game. Their first big test of the season is this coming Sunday in New England. 9. Minnesota Vikings Such a let down and shocking loss to the Buffalo Bills last week. It has actually taken some of the juice out of their big matchup this Thursday night vs. the Rams. But it could also be looked at as the wake up call needed for the team. We shall see. 10. Pittsburgh Steelers Their season was saved on Monday Night even though they nearly blew a 20 point lead in Tampa.
